Many winches come with synthetic rope, which is much easier to handle than steel cable, the most popular tether spooled on most winches. Synthetic rope is just as strong as steel cable, and much easier to handle because it’s flexible. It won’t get burrs (which can penetrate your skin if you’re not wearing gloves), and it won’t kink or fray. But if you’ll be doing a lot of rock climbing, or using it anyplace where the cable would be exposed to abrasion, or if you’ll be using the winch to haul timber or other heavy items, steel is the better choice. It’ll stand up to rough use.
